Saskatchewan's Poupon Technologies crew, including Levi Reoch, Justin Schwan, Levi Wawryk, Taylor Mabbott, and Ethan Reoch recently packed up and hit the city of San Francisco. Word is their time was filled with challenging the hills, testing out famous spots, eating too many burritos, and making one too many hospital visits. One being too many.

Filmed and edited by Liam Trainor.

Back to blog